Faculty members in the Finance Area conduct research in corporate finance, asset pricing, macro-finance, real estate and neuroeconomics. Our mission is to conduct high-impact and high-quality work that advances our understanding of the economic decisions made by investors, firms and policy-makers. In addition to our three existing Finance research centers, the School recently launched the Institute for Private Capital (IPC). The IPC will principally focus on research leading to a better understanding of private capital investments. The properties and impacts of private investments are poorly understood relative to public investment vehicles and represent a major blind spot in the academic knowledge base. A better understanding of private investments will directly impact practice and have important public policy implications.
